I like challenges like the Seattle Public Library's summer book bingo, or re-reading all the Discworld books in a logical order. What's something I could do along those lines, but for TV? Not necessarily "Watch every episode of (this particular series)" but something more complex?
I'm in the US and have or can get all the usual streaming services. Any language is fine so long as it has English subtitles, but the preference is English or Japanese. At the end I'd like to feel like I accomplished or learned something, but being entertained along the way is the most important aspect. |
